While you were sleeping a little thing called the Golden Globes took place over in Hollywood. Emma Stone and Julianne Moore were winners on the red carpet, but who went home with a gong? It was a British invasion with awards for Eddie Redmayne, Boyhood and Downton Abbey.
British actor Eddie Redmayne went home with Best Actor in a Drama award for his portrayal of Stephen Hawking in Theory of Everything. Meanwhile Julianne Moore, who wowed in Givenchy sequins and feathers, won the Best Actress in a drama award for her performance in* Still Alice*.
Best Actress in a musical or comedy went to Amy Adams for Big Eyes, while Best Actor in this category went to Michael Keaton for Birdman. Boyhood was a big winner, receiving the awards for Best Motion Picture, Best Director and Best Supporting Actress.

THE WINNERS
![Julianne Moore wins Best Actress [Getty]](https://images.bauerhosting.com/legacy/lifestyle-legacy/49/25cef/780d5/809b7/c643d/7e8f4/05159/461379950_1060x644.jpg?auto=format&w=1440&q=80)
Best Motion Picture - Drama - Boyhood
Best Motion Picture - Musical or Comedy - The Grand Budapest Hotel
Best Director - Richard Linklater for Boyhood.
Best Actress - Drama - Julianne Moore for Still Alice
Best Actor - Drama - Eddie Redmayne for Theory of Everything
**Best Actress - Musical or Comedy **- Amy Adams for Big Eyes
Best Actor - Musical or Comedy - Michael Keaton for Birdman
**Best Supporting Actress - **Patricia Arquette for Boyhood
**Best Supporting Actor - **JK Simmons for Whiplash
Best Screenplay - Alejandro González Iñárritu, Nicolás Giacobone, Alexander Dinelaris, Armando Bo for Birdman
Best Foreign Language Film- Leviathan (Russia)
Best Animated Feature - How To Train Your Dragon 2
**Best Original Score - **Jóhann Jóhannsson for Theory of Everything
**Best TV Drama Series - **Transparent
**Best Miniseries or TV Movie - **Fargo
**Best Actress in a Drama Series - Ruth Wilson for The Affair
**
**Best Actor in a Drama Series - Kevin Spacey for House of Cards
**
Best Actor in a Comedy Series - Jeffrey Tambor for Transparent
**Best Actress in a Comedy Series - **Gina Rodriguez for Jane the Virgin
**Best Actor in a Limited Series - **Billy Bob Thornton for Fargo
**Best Actress in a Limited Series - Maggie Gyllenhaal
**
**Best Supporting Actress - **Joanne Froggatt for Downton Abbey
**Best Supporting Actor - **Matt Bomer for The Normal Heart
